Nurturing


 
Like goldenrod they come up unbidden
           Weeds uninvited in the world
But, someone let them get a start and now,
           They grow on stocks that need no tending.
           Weeds unbidden, uninvited in the world. 
 Given elaborate names - constructed from glittering words
           Names so spectacular that no one could utter them
                       They speak strength, beauty and awe.

Such an audacious start
Without nurturing support ­or extravagance of spirit squandered on them they are left to sink roots into such soil as they find.
To make their way in the world.
 
I wonder ­
            Will the world be as kind to Jamyron and Vandasha as it is to the Goldenrod
                         Growing unbidden, uninvited in the world?
            Lavished with sunlight and showers, gentle breezes,

                          and  just enough space along the roadside to bloom. 
                                     And Jamyron?  And Vandasha?
